Man that almost sounds familiar. I never had a problem but that once. They state that so you won't mount the pump above the fuel cell. Having it mounted behind the gas tank even though its slightly above the bottom of the tank isn't going to kill it. The force of the car moving forward should help push the fuel to the back of the tank, and towards the pump.
